Configuring Interfaces

The following command sequences create a system and a logical IP interface. The system interface
assigns an IP address to the interface, and then associates the IP interface with a physical port. The
logical interface can associate attributes like an IP address or port.

Note that the system interface cannot be deleted.

Configuring a System Interface

To configure a system interface:

CLI Syntax:

config>router

interface ip-int-name

address ip-addr{/mask-length|mask} [broadcast {all-

ones|host-ones}]

secondary {[ip-addr/mask|ip-addr][netmask]} [broadcast

{all-ones|host-ones}] [igp-inhibit]

Example

:

config>router# interface system

config>router>if# address 10.10.10.104/32

config>router>if# exit

Configuring a Network Interface

To configure a network interface:

CLI Syntax:

config>router

interface ip-int-name

address ip-addr{/mask-length | mask} [broadcast {all-

ones | host-ones}]

cflowd {acl | interface}

egress

filter ip ip-filter-id

filter ipv6 ipv6-filter-id

ingress

filter ip ip-filter-id

filter ipv6 ipv6-filter-id

port [port-id | ccag-group]

Example

:

config>router> interface “to-ALA-2

config>router>if# address 10.10.24.4/24

config>router>if# port 8/1/1

config>router>if# egress
